Davenport Public Transit System

Location Name
Davenport Public Transit System
Charles J. Wright Transportation Center, 300 West River Drive, Davenport, IA 52801
Public Transit System (CITIBUS) runs several fixed routes.  Each bus is lift-equipped according to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) standards, and has a bicycle rack that will accommodate two bicycles. Reduced fares are available for unemployed, seniors, disabled, and all Medicare recipients. Davenport Schools students (K-12) as well as Palmer and St. Ambrose college students ride free with current school ID. Paratransit service is provided for those who are unable to use a fixed route system due to physical or mental disability.

River Valley Metro Mass Transit District

Location Name
River Valley Metro Mass Transit District
1137 East 5000N Road, Bourbonnais, IL 60914

Buses act as free cooling and warming stations during extreme weather during normal business hours. Anyone who needs a place to stay warm or cool is encouraged to use these buses as warming/cooling centers or to ride a bus to a safe location.

Stations:

  • Warming: When the wind chill is zero or below, rides on all local fixed route buses are free
  • Cooling: When the heat index is 100 degrees or higher, rides on all local fixed route buses are free

Decatur Public Transit System

Location Name
Decatur Public Transit System
555 East Wood Street, Decatur, IL 62523

Operates 15 bus routes and a downtown trolley route on a pulse system with buses departing the downtown Transit Center at 15 and 45 minutes past each hour.

Also provides the Operation Uplift door-to-door paratransit service for individuals who are unable to use the fixed route bus system due to a disability. Paratransit is available during the same days/hours as the fixed route bus system but operates on a demand responsive basis.

MetroLINK

Location Name
MetroLINK
1515 River Drive, Moline, IL 61265
Public transportation to Rock Island, Milan, Moline, East Moline, Silvis, Carbon Cliff, Colona, and Hampton; connecting routes to Iowa are available. Channel Cat water taxi operates Memorial Day through Labor Day, including weekends, weather permitting; cost is $8 for adults, and $4 for children ages 2-10; tickets are for all day unlimited use on day of purchase. Ticket agent for Greyhound Lines and Burlington Trailways at Centre Station in Moline.

Metro Transit Headquarters

Location Name
Metro Transit Headquarters
2222 Cuming Street, Omaha, NE 68102

Bus service within Omaha city limits, Bellevue, Council Bluffs, Ralston, Papillion, and LaVista. Weekday a.m. and p.m. rush hour Express Service to and from downtown Omaha.

Express ORBT Bus Service available on Dodge Street in Omaha.

Bus route schedules and maps are available online. Riders can track buses live at myride.ometro.com. Users may also sign up for MyRide text alerts to be notified of any service interruptions, detours, or closed stops. Printed schedules are available by request at Metro headquarters or riders can call customer service for help.

Employers may have pass programs for employees or students that allow them to ride the bus with their employee or student ID; employees should ask their Human Resources Departments what mass transit options they offer.

Bettendorf Transit System

Location Name
Bettendorf Transit System
4403 Devils Glen Road, Bettendorf, IA 52722
Transit system serving the city of Bettendorf.  Buses are low-floor, light duty, equipped with ramps, and seat 21 passengers.  Three routes run every sixty minutes, including a connecting route to the Moline terminal and connections to Davenport CitiBus. Dial-A-Bus service (also Paratransit) is available to all Bettendorf residents during regular hours under contract with River Bend Transit.  24 hour advance reservation is highly recommended, 563-386-1350.
